A strong earthquake occurred in Turkey

A 4.7-magnitude earthquake hit the Baskale district of Turkey's Van province.

Axar.az reports this was stated by the Kandilli Observatory.

At 08:39 local time, the quake occurred at a depth of 5 km.

No casualties or damage were reported.
